Preparing this quick radicchio pesto is really simple: wash the radicchio, dry it well, and chop it into large pieces. Then mix everything in a blender with garlic, walnuts, pine nuts, grated cheese, a pinch of salt, and extra virgin olive oil. In a few minutes, you’ll have a creamy, fragrant, and super versatile sauce ready.
Homemade radicchio pesto is perfect for seasoning pasta, spreading on crostini, enriching risottos, or adding character to a gourmet sandwich. It’s a vegetarian recipe, full of flavor, and ideal for those looking for an alternative to the classic Genoese pesto.

- Cost: Very cheap
- Preparation time: 5 Minutes
- Portions: 4 People
- Cooking methods: No cooking
- Cuisine: Italian
- Seasonality: All seasons, Fall, Winter, and Spring
Ingredients
RADICCHIO PESTO
- 7 oz radicchio
- 1 garlic
- 3.5 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- 1.5 oz walnuts
- 1.5 oz pine nuts
- 3.5 tbsp grated cheese
- to taste salt
Tools
- 1 Chopper bosch chopper
- 1 Cutting Board cutting board
Steps
Start by washing the radicchio leaves, removing the outer ones, and cutting off the final core.
Dry them, cut into pieces, and place in a blender.
Add walnuts, pine nuts, garlic, salt, and blend.
Add the Parmesan and extra virgin olive oil and blend again until you obtain a thick and creamy pesto.
The radicchio pesto is ready!
